About Yaoqing Gao
Yaoqing Gao is a scholar working on Hardware and Architecture, Software and Computer Networks and Communications, having authored 24 papers that have together received 424 indexed citations. Recurring topics across this work include Parallel Computing and Optimization Techniques (14 papers), Advanced Data Storage Technologies (8 papers) and Distributed and Parallel Computing Systems (6 papers). The work is most often cited by research in Hardware and Architecture (354 citations), Computer Networks and Communications (309 citations) and Software (26 citations). Yaoqing Gao has collaborated with scholars based in Canada, United States and Australia. Frequent co-authors include María Jesús Garzarán, David Padua, Saeed Maleki, Chen Ding, Peng Zhao, Xipeng Shen, Raúl Silvera, José Nelson Amaral, Yunlian Jiang and John O’Brien. Their work appears in journals such as IEEE Transactions on Software Engineering, ACM SIGPLAN Notices and ACM Transactions on Programming Languages and Systems.
